Diesel additive and synthetic technology thereof
A synthesis process and additive technology, applied in the field of diesel additives and their synthesis technology, can solve the problems of single function, inability to improve the service life of the engine, and insignificant fuel-saving effect, and achieve simple preparation process, reduce friction and noise, and improve combustion. Embodiment 1
[0014] The diesel additive components include 5 parts of cetyltrimethylammonium bromide, 3 parts of oleic acid, 4 parts of acetamide, 8 parts of dimethyl carbonate, 7 parts of glycerol, and 10 parts of detergent and dispersant in parts by weight. , 5 parts of dimethyl oxalate, 3 parts of 5-methyl-2-hepten-4-one, 5 parts of ethylene glycol monobutyl ether, and 2 parts of methylcyclopentadiene manganese tricarbonyl.
[0015] The synthesis technique of the present embodiment comprises the following steps:
[0016] A. Mix cetyltrimethylammonium bromide, oleic acid, acetamide, and dimethyl carbonate and add them to the stirring tank for stirring. The stirring tank speed is 2000 rpm, and the stirring time is 10 minutes. Agent A;
